    With the kind permission of this Forum, we'd like to invite Nat Pres contributors to our Open Day at Blythburgh Station on Sunday April 3rd, 10 till 4. Free entry, free tea/coffee.
    Blythburgh Station is off the A12 just north of Blythburgh village - turn almost opposite the White Hart - there are signs.
    We have cleared the 1879 platform, and have permission to lay the main line alongside, with connections to the sidings. It's very much a work in progress - but come and have a chat and a cuppa with us. If you like what you see - maybe sponsor a sleeper (£35.00)
    Events will be held there also on Suffolk Day (Tuesday 21st June) and on Sunday September 11th (with a model show)
